"Dan" <falseflyboy@yahoo.comNONO> writes:

> i messed up my read/access by using chmod...will someone tell me the default
> umask for /var/ftp/incoming

There's no default, really, because that directory doesn't exist by
default.  What you want the permissions to be depends on, among other
things, who owns it.  See the ftpd(8) manual for instructions on
setting up an anonymous FTP directory.
